Neat (and kinda creepy) Cities Service Oil Company "CRAZY CONES" child's costume dated 1960.
It is a kraft paper cone that measures about 36" tall and 34" wide when flat. The seam is in the back and the sides are creased. There are arms holes in each side and a face hole in the front center.
I did a quick search and found no information or similar item. I assume this was a promotional item available at your local Cities Service gas station in time for Halloween in 1960.
Found in the bedroom closet at an old estate sale where it has apparently laid on a shelf for decades so has some shelf wear and rub. Couple spots of foxing. Appears to have been worn at least a few times. There are stains around the head hole and along the front that could be old candy stains from trick or treating. Shows wear and staining consistent with age. A few short rips along the holes and the creased edges as shown in pictures. Displays well. See pictures for condition of EXACTLY what you will receive.
